Artist: Louden Silas (Hopi Tribe)
Dimensions: 3 3/4" Tall x 3 3/4" Wide
Description: Traditional Hopi hand made Tile fired outdoors by Louden Silas. It has the following designs painted on the front: Bird Flying to the South, Kiva, Warrior Marks on Kachina Ear, Kachina Ears, Water Waves, Corn Purity on the Edge (Prayers for the Kachinas to come back and heal the people)! It is hand formed, painted with natural pigments from the earth and fired outdoors the traditional way! Louden is the Granddaughter of Roberta Silas and Daughter of Daren Silas & Renee Silas Aguilar.
